Weekly Outline
Feb 25 Introduction: Angles and Polygons Basic shapes
Mar 3 Regular (Platonic) Solids Skeletal Octahedron
Mar 10 Tetrahedron, Octahedron Modular Octahedron
Mar 17 Cube, Duality Cube, Tetrahedron in cube
Mar 24 Rotational Symmetries Four or Six circles
Mar 31 Icosahedron Modular Icosahedron
Apr 7 Dodecahedron Skeletal Dodecahedron
Apr 14 Semi-regular (Archimedean) Solids Cuboctahedron
Apr 21 Duality revisited Rhombic Dodecahedron
Apr 28 Stellations (Kepler Solids) Stellated Dodecahedron
May 5 Poinsot Solids Great Dodecahedron
May 12 Plane-Filling Shapes Tessellations
May 26 Space-Filling Shapes Truncated Octahedron
